Why can’t I install Windows 10 on a GPT partition?

If you see the prompt saying “Windows Cannot be installed to this disk. The selected disk is of the GPT partition style”, that’s because your PC is booted in UEFI mode, but your hard drive is not configured for UEFI mode. How to take care of this GPT partition style issue?

What is GPT partition style?

What Is GPT Partition Style? GPT is part of the UEFI standard, which means a UEFI-based system should be installed on a GPT disk. GPT partition style allows you to create theoretically unlimited partitions on the disk and enables you to fully use disks that are larger than 2TB.
